Randstad Digital logo

Software Developer - Full Stack - C# / .NET

Randstad Digital

Toronto, Canada

Share this job:
$3 - $5 Posted: 1 day ago

Job Description

<p> C# / .NET Software Developer (Full-Stack) - Financial Services</p><p><br></p><p>Our client, a leading independent administrator in the alternative investment fund industry, is seeking an <b>energetic and reliable Full-Stack Software Developer</b> to join their established agile development team in <b>downtown Toronto</b>.</p><p>This is a <b>full-time permanent position</b> offering the opportunity to contribute to the development of proprietary, industry-leading financial services software. The client is known for its exceptional workplace culture and is committed to <b>professional growth and career development</b>.</p><p><br></p><p><br></p><p><br></p><p><br></p><p><b> NOTE - </b>If you possess the relevant experience, with 5+ years of Full Stack, C# / .NET Development, and have knowledge and a background with FinTech, Accounting, Finance or related along with extensive IT experience - feel free to forward your up to date CV directly to <b> </b>for consideration. - Due to volumes, only those with the relevant experience that is outlined directly on the CV will be contacted to discuss further.</p><p><br></p><p><br></p><p><br></p><p><br></p><p>Key Responsibilities</p><p><br></p><p>Reporting to the Software Development Manager, you will be responsible for the full lifecycle of their core in-house system:</p><ul><li><b>Application Development and Enhancement:</b> Design, develop, test, and deploy software features based on defined requirements.</li><li><b>Requirements Definition:</b> Collaborate closely with business analysts and end-users to gather functional requirements and inform application design.</li><li><b>System Support:</b> Provide limited application support outside of regular business hours.</li><li><b>Team Collaboration:</b> Work effectively within the agile team, manage deliverables, and communicate potential issues that could impact users or clients to management.</li><li><b>Process Improvement:</b> Continually seek to improve processes associated with assigned functions.</li></ul><p><br></p><p> ️ Required Technical Skills & Experience</p><p><br></p><p>We are looking for a <b>Full-Stack Software Developer</b> with 5+ years of overall experience, including a minimum of <b>3-5 years dedicated to C# .NET development</b>.</p><p><br></p><p>Core Technical Expertise:</p><p><br></p><ul><li><b>Expertise in C# .NET</b> application development, covering the full lifecycle: coding, testing, deployment, and maintenance.</li><li>Working knowledge of <b>relational database development utilizing MS SQL</b>.</li><li>Functional knowledge of <b>Object-Oriented Programming (OOP)</b> and design principles.</li><li>Proven track record of delivering software projects on time.</li></ul><p><br></p><p>Desirable Frameworks and Architecture:</p><p><br></p><ul><li>Experience with <b>ASP.NET MVC</b> and <b>AngularJS</b>.</li><li>Knowledge of <b>WCF, XML</b>, and <b>Service-Oriented Architecture (SOA)</b>.</li></ul><p><br></p><p> Ideal Candidate Profile & Soft Skills</p><p><br></p><p>The ideal candidate is a <b>bright, innovative, and quick learner</b> with a <b>strong commitment to continuous learning</b>.</p><ul><li><b>Collaboration:</b> Excellent team player with kindness and strong collaboration skills.</li><li><b>Communication:</b> Excellent verbal and written communication skills and inter-personal skills.</li><li><b>Work Ethic:</b> Ability to work effectively with minimal supervision, prioritize tasks, and demonstrate strong attention to detail.</li><li><b>Mindset:</b> Possesses a reasonable sense of humor; takes the work seriously, but not themselves.</li></ul><p><br></p><p>Preferred Background (Industry Focus)</p><p><br></p><ul><li><b>Highly Desired:</b> Experience from <b>alternative fund administrators, financial technology (Fintech) providers</b>, or developers from <b>stock exchanges</b> (e.g., TSX, Nasdaq).</li><li><b>Strong Asset:</b> Background from small to mid-sized <b>hedge funds, mutual funds, or private equity firms</b> with experience developing <b>proprietary software</b>.</li><li><b>Academic/Designation Plus:</b> Education in <b>Computer Science</b> combined with <b>Finance/Accounting</b> or relevant designations (e.g., CFA, CSC).</li></ul><p><br></p><p> Benefits</p><p><br></p><ul><li><b>Benefits:</b> Full benefits package including health and dental for employees and families, life/AD&D/travel insurance, and a <b>group retirement plan with company match</b>.</li><li><b>Work Model:</b> Hybrid work model offering flexibility between remote work and time in the <b>downtown Toronto</b> office.</li></ul><p></p>
Back to Listings

Create Your Resume First

Give yourself the best chance of success. Create a professional, job-winning resume with AI before you apply.

It's fast, easy, and increases your chances of getting an interview!

Create Resume

Application Disclaimer

You are now leaving Jobiend.com and being redirected to a third-party website to complete your application. We are not responsible for the content or privacy practices of this external site.

Important: Beware of job scams. Never provide your bank account details, credit card information, or any form of payment to a potential employer.